Hi all,
i'm in the UK and was wondering if anyone knew what differences between the EU and the US ecu map are if any? and how this will impact on any tuning i do.... I currently have a 'Fuel' slip on exhaust and am considering removing the secondaries also, i know some have done this successfully and say the bike runs fine without ant fuel adder and the plugs etc are perfect.
I think these guys are in the us so i may get different results.

I am Australian, we run the same fuels. 'Mericans use a different scale to rate their fuels:eek2: The one thing that I think is also very relevant is my O2 sensor has never been bypassed/unplugged. This means the stock system will compensate;even if it is to a limited degree,for the mods I have. My main reason for not having a fuel adder is the lack of a Dyno within 200 odd miles of me.
